Overview
The Zebra 56068-002 is a digital font pack designed to extend the character set and typographic capabilities of compatible Zebra printing systems. This font pack adds Andale Japanese language support, enabling organizations operating in Japanese-speaking regions or serving multilingual customer bases to render localized text directly from printer firmware without external encoding workarounds.
The 56068-002 font pack integrates seamlessly into Zebra printer device memory, allowing operators to select and deploy Japanese character sets during print job configuration. This approach reduces complexity in international supply chain labeling, warehouse management, and logistics operations where region-specific labeling is mandatory or operationally advantageous.

Integration & Compatibility
The 56068-002 font pack supports deployment across Zebra printer models that include expandable firmware font storage. Organizations managing warehouses, logistics hubs, or retail operations in Asia-Pacific regions benefit from native Japanese rendering without requiring label template redesign or operator retraining on character encoding methods. The font pack is delivered as a digital license and installation package, with deployment managed through Zebra printer management tools or direct printer configuration interfaces.
Deployment Considerations
Before deployment, verify that your Zebra printer model and firmware version support extended font pack installation. Font pack installation typically requires printer restart or configuration reset. Once installed, the Andale Japanese font becomes permanently available in printer firmware and does not consume user-accessible print memory. Organizations operating multi-site printer fleets should coordinate deployment timing to ensure consistent label output across locations.
